What days are the Apple Festival in Ellijay Georgia? The 2022 Georgia Apple Festival will take place October 8-9 and October 15-16. Admission is $10 for adults; children under 12 are admitted free. A convenient free shuttle will transport visitors from the parking lots to the festival venue.

How is the weather in Georgia in October?
Daily high temperatures decrease by 9°F, from 77°F to 68°F, rarely falling below 57°F or exceeding 85°F. Daily low temperatures decrease by 11°F, from 59°F to 48°F, rarely falling below 37°F or exceeding 68°F.

What is the best time to see fall colors in Georgia?
Only Mother Nature knows, of course, but peak color in Georgia is usually toward the end of October or early November. The key for a vibrant autumn is warm sunny days coupled with cool – not freezing – nights.
Does Atlanta have fall foliage?
The fall foliage season in Atlanta usually runs from early October to mid-November, with a peak in late October or early November. Some areas see the change of color as early as late September, but you would want to aim for the peak season to get the most stunning views of fall colors in and around Atlanta.
Are the leaves changing in Blue Ridge GA?
Peak Times for Fall Foliage in Blue Ridge, Georgia
October 10 – 20: This date range is peak time for elevations from 4,000 to 5,000 feet. October 18 – 26: This date range is peak time for elevations from 3,000 to 4,000 feet. October 24 – 31: This date range is peak for elevations from 2,000 to 3,000 feet.

What is peak leaf season in North Georgia?
Fortunately, Georgia’s variety of tree species ensures you can count on a show of fall colors each year. Normally, the optimum time to see the leaf change in the north Georgia mountains is the last weekend in October. If you are going into the higher elevations, subtract a week.
